Test instruments to measure magnetic field strengths are often based on the Hall effect. In one instrument, the “probe” is a 1.0-mm-thick, 6.0-mm-wide semiconductor with a charge-carrier density of 2.1 × 1021 m-3, much less than the charge-carrier density in a conductor. Passing a 60 mA current through the probe generates a Hall voltage of 120 mV. What is the magnetic field strength?
